3 – Distribution Service Options
Bayside Letterbox Distribution offers two distribution services: Single Item Delivery and Bundled Delivery.
3.1 – Single Item Delivery
Single Item Delivery involves the distribution of a single advertising item per letterbox, where the client’s material is the only advertising item carried by walkers in the selected delivery area on the day of distribution.
Under this service:
Flyers are placed in the letters section of eligible letterboxes only.
Delivery areas are monitored using GPS mapping for internal auditing purposes. GPS data is retained for up to four (4) weeks only.
Distribution scheduling is subject to availability and campaigns are scheduled on a first-in, first-served basis.
Printed materials must be delivered to our warehouse at least two (2) business days prior to the scheduled distribution commencement. Late delivery of materials may result in delays to distribution.
3.2 Bundled Delivery
Bundled Delivery is an aggregated distribution service where advertising material is delivered together with other catalogues or advertising items within a bundle.
Under this service:
The client’s material forms part of a bundle distributed for that week.
The bundle is placed in the newspapers section of eligible letterboxes.
Bundles may contain multiple advertising items or catalogues.
The number and type of materials included in any bundle cannot be predicted in advance.
This service is not GPS tracked.
Distribution typically commences within approximately eight (8) business days from the Wednesday following receipt of stock, subject to operational scheduling.
Due to the aggregated nature of bundled delivery, distribution may occur across sections of a suburb rather than every street within the suburb.
Bundled delivery is designed as a cost-efficient service intended to provide broad exposure rather than guaranteed suburb-wide saturation.

5 – Estimated Delivery Coverage
Due to the presence of “No Junk Mail” signage, inaccessible properties, apartment access restrictions, and other delivery limitations, advertising material may reach less than the total number of residences within a suburb or delivery area.
Distribution quantities are therefore based on estimated eligible letterboxes rather than total dwellings within a suburb or delivery area.
